## Approvals: log sampling for Burrowtalk

Burrowtalk emits an unusually high volume of debug logs, so all plugin-originated log lines are sampled at 1-in-50 by default. Plugin authors requesting a higher sampling rate must file an approval ticket describing volume estimates, retention impact, and the fields emitted. Approvals are granted for 90 days and must be renewed. All sampling-rate exception requests are reviewed and signed off by the approver named below.

named custodian: Brivan Eliath Quenox Frador

## Onboarding: Farebranch Rules Engine

Plugin authors integrate with Farebranch by registering fee rules against the evaluation API. Rules are sandboxed; they cannot perform network calls directly. All rate-table lookups go through the host, which validates your plugin manifest at load time. Your local env file must include the signing credential the host uses to verify manifests, set on the next line.

secret setting of bajef-fajof: COURIER_KEY3=76c

Runbook: migrating Quillhaven's cron jobs to the Lattice workflow engine. Each job's service account is scoped to a single queue, and secrets are injected at dispatch time rather than stored in the job spec. Audit logging is enabled for every transition. The worker reads the following settings at startup, shown here for review.

config for kafof-bawef:
holath:
  log_level: debug
  metrics_host: metrics.holath.qorvelsys.internal
  pin: 2191
  pool_size: 32